You might be underage or too young to remember, but Clarin and TyC owned the rights to transmit all football matches from the Primera A for 16 years (1992-2009). You needed to pay the premium service or buy a knock-off deco (which would stop working randomly as the cable companies caught up). The only football basic cable showed was European (ESPN).

The trend of European sympathizers are 20-30yos who used to be underage back then. They were taught that everything from the USA or Europe was better (Me*em lo hizo), and it was the beginning of European leagues stealing thousands of players to fill every fucking position to make football more competitive and eye-catching.
There was PC Futbol, FIFA, Winning Eleven. All sports games that had no local leagues. Sports shirts from international football teams were imported by the thousands.
